How GSM Transformed Everyday Life in Nigeria — Ernest Ndukwe Recalls Telecom Revolution

Nigeria’s telecommunications industry has come a remarkably long way from the days when owning a telephone line was almost a luxury.

Today, a mobile phone is used for virtually everything, making calls, sending money, running businesses, attending meetings, accessing social media, learning, shopping and staying connected with family and friends.

But getting Nigeria to that point was far from easy.

Dr Ernest Ndukwe, who served as Executive Vice Chairman of the Nigerian Communications Commission (NCC) between 2000 and 2010, has provided fresh insight into the difficult decisions, regulatory battles and infrastructure problems that shaped the country’s telecommunications revolution.

Ndukwe, who previously spent 11 years leading General Telecom Plc and was also active in Nigeria’s private telecommunications industry, was appointed to head the NCC at a critical period when the country was preparing for a major change in telecommunications.

At the time, Nigeria was lagging behind several African countries in mobile telecommunications, while the state-owned NITEL was struggling to provide adequate services.

Looking back, Ndukwe said one of the biggest challenges was creating a system that could attract serious investors while also ensuring that the country’s limited telecommunications resources were distributed fairly.

Nigeria Had a Phone Problem Long Before GSM Arrived

The Nigerian Communications Commission was established in 1992 under Decree 75 during the military era, with the responsibility of regulating the telecommunications sector.

At the time, NITEL dominated the industry and was the country’s major telecommunications provider.

However, the company’s poor performance created growing pressure for competition and private-sector participation.

Ndukwe recalled that Nigeria was already falling behind countries such as Algeria, Cameroon and Ghana, which had begun introducing GSM services before Nigeria.

Before GSM arrived, the NCC had licensed several telecommunications companies, including Intercellular, Multilinks, Starcomms, Mobitel, Zoom Mobile and others.

But the sector lacked a coordinated approach to spectrum allocation.

Different companies had received different quantities of spectrum, with some holding 5MHz, others 7.5MHz and others 10MHz.

According to Ndukwe, this created an uneven foundation for competition.

When he became NCC Executive Vice Chairman in February 2000, one of his major responsibilities was therefore to bring order to the situation.

Recovering Nigeria’s Scattered Spectrum Was a Major Battle

For any mobile network to operate, it needs access to radio frequency spectrum.

Nigeria’s problem was that the available spectrum had already been distributed in small and uneven portions.

Ndukwe said the NCC decided that operators needed a fair and transparent process that would give serious investors an opportunity to compete on relatively equal terms.

That meant recovering spectrum that had already been allocated.

The process was not straightforward.

Ndukwe worked with officials of the Ministry of Communications to develop a framework for recovering the frequencies. Some companies resisted the move strongly, with one or two even taking the government to court.

Despite the resistance, the NCC eventually recovered sufficient spectrum in the 900MHz and 1800MHz bands, which could support GSM and CDMA services.

Consultants were subsequently brought in to help structure the recovered spectrum into auction slots.

The arrangement eventually provided four 5MHz slots in the 900MHz band and 15MHz in the 1800MHz band for each successful bidder.

That process laid the groundwork for the major telecommunications licensing exercise that followed.

Nigeria Had Just 400,000 Fixed Lines Before the Mobile Boom

Spectrum was only one side of the problem.

Nigeria also had a serious shortage of telecommunications infrastructure.

Ndukwe recalled that the country had a population of roughly 120 million people at the time but only around 400,000 fixed telephone lines.

The situation was even worse with mobile services, where there were only about 20,000 analogue mobile lines.

For a country of Nigeria’s size, the figures showed just how enormous the infrastructure gap was.

The government therefore needed private investors capable of building thousands of base stations, expanding coverage and introducing modern telecommunications technology at a speed that the existing system could not achieve.

That was one of the reasons attracting credible local and international operators became such an important part of the NCC’s strategy.

Why the NCC Did Not Simply Call It a GSM Auction

Interestingly, the licensing exercise was not originally designed specifically as a GSM auction.

Ndukwe explained that the NCC deliberately called it a Digital Spectrum Auction.

The reason was simple: regulators did not want to force operators into adopting one particular technology.

While GSM was widely used in Europe and many other countries, CDMA had also gained popularity in places such as the United States.

The NCC therefore wanted operators to have the freedom to choose the technology they believed was best suited to their businesses.

Companies that obtained licences could deploy either GSM or CDMA.

In the end, however, all three successful operators chose GSM.

The 2001 Auction Opened the Door to Nigeria’s Mobile Era

The landmark digital spectrum auction took place in January 2001.

Five companies participated, but only three successfully emerged from the process.

They were required to pay their licence fees by February 14, 2001.

One spectrum slot was also reserved for NITEL as the incumbent operator.

Of the three companies that qualified through the auction process, MTN Nigeria and Econet paid their licence fees within the required period, while CIL failed to meet the payment deadline.

The resulting digital mobile licences went to MTN Nigeria, Econet and NITEL.

All three eventually opted for GSM technology.

That decision marked one of the most important turning points in Nigeria’s telecommunications history.

From Scarce Phone Lines to Phones in Almost Every Hand

The significance of the GSM revolution went far beyond making phone calls easier.

It changed how Nigerians communicated and gradually transformed how businesses operated.

For many Nigerians who lived through the period, the difference was dramatic.

A time when getting a fixed telephone line could involve long delays eventually gave way to a situation where someone could buy a SIM card, put it into a mobile phone and begin communicating almost immediately.

The mobile phone also became much more than a communication device.

It created new opportunities for small businesses, enabled people to remain connected across different cities and countries, and eventually became a major platform for financial services, online commerce, entertainment and digital work.

The telecommunications industry also created thousands of direct and indirect jobs, from network engineering and retail to phone repairs, distribution, digital services and mobile content.

The Telecom Revolution Became the Foundation for Nigeria’s Digital Economy

The transformation that began with GSM has continued through several generations of mobile technology.

2G made mobile voice and text communication widely accessible. Later, 3G and 4G expanded mobile internet access, allowing Nigerians to use their phones for services that would have been difficult to imagine during the pre-GSM era.

The growth of smartphones, mobile banking, social media, online businesses and digital platforms has further increased the importance of telecommunications infrastructure in everyday Nigerian life.

Today, discussions around 5G and emerging technologies are taking place on a foundation that was built during those early years of telecom liberalisation.

For Ndukwe, the lessons from that period remain relevant as Nigeria continues to develop its digital economy.

The country’s telecommunications revolution was not achieved simply by introducing a new type of mobile phone technology. It required regulatory reform, spectrum management, private investment and the construction of infrastructure on a scale Nigeria had not previously experienced.

And perhaps the biggest evidence of how successful that transformation became is how difficult it is to imagine everyday Nigerian life without the mobile phone.
